#2e7cda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2e7cda is composed of 18% red, 48.6%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.9% cyan, 43.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 212.8 degrees, a saturation of 69.9% and a lightness of 51.8%. #2e7cda color hex could be obtained by blending #5cf8ff with #0000b5.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#2e7cda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2e7cda has RGB values of R:46, G:124,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0.43,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 3046618.

Shades and Tints of #2e7cda
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010408 is the darkest color, while #f6f9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#2e7cda
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838485 is the less saturated color, while #1279f6 is the most saturated one.
